Meredith Olmstead, CEO of FI GROW Solutions, and Duncan Craig, leader of agency Raka, discuss the importance and budgeting for websites, especially for financial institutions.
Key Takeaways:
- A well-budgeted website for financial institutions should range around $150,000 to ensure quality, strategy, and flexibility.
- Underspending on websites can lead to reduced functionality, lesser shelf life, and possible non-compliance with ADA standards.
- Financial institutions need to prioritize their online presence as it is often the primary point of engagement for most customers today.
